Jiffy Lube Co-op Parks at Sedgwick Rd.

Inspiration meets innovation at Brandweek, the ultimate marketing experience. Join industry luminaries, rising talent and strategic experts in Phoenix, Arizona this September 23–26 to assess challenges, develop solutions and create new pathways for growth. Register early to save.

LOS ANGELES Interpublic Group’s Sedgwick Rd. has won the $3 million regional Jiffy Lube advertising account, the client confirmed.

Sedgwick Rd. won the review last week against Seattle independent Copacino + Fujikado, after Seattle indies WongDoody and Hadley Green had been cut from the final four, said Gene Thompson, CEO of Seattle-based Thompson Family Jiffy Lubes, which co-owns the ad cooperative with Heartland Automotive.

The incumbent was independent Kovel/Fuller, Culver City, Calif., which retains a portion of the regional business.
